R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
255, 226, 218
Red: 255 / Green: 226 / Blue: 218
HSL
13°, 100%, 93%
Hue: 13° / Saturation: 100% / Lightness: 93%
CMYK
0%, 11%, 15%, 0%
Cyan: 0% / Magenta: 11% / Yellow: 15% / Key: 0%

Color Meaning and Usage
#FFE2DA is a light red color with RGB values of 255, 226, 218 and HSL of 13°, 100%, 93%. This very light tint evokes purity and simplicity, making it suitable for commonly used in modern UI design.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#FFE2DA is #DBF7FF,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#FFDBE5.
